Job Description:

Oasis Academy Hadley is looking for a bold, energetic leader to head up Art & Technology. Someone who can bring a team together, raise the bar on teaching and learning, and make the creative curriculum a genuine "heartbeat" of the school. We're an all-through Academy (ages 2-19) with a strong sense of community, high expectations and a culture where staff are supported to grow and thrive.

Job Responsibility:

  • Lead, develop and inspire the Art & Technology team, driving strong outcomes and a culture of excellent teaching
  • shape and refine the curriculum so it builds skill, confidence and creativity, and meets the needs of all learners
  • coach and support colleagues through thoughtful line management, collaboration and day-to-day leadership
  • use assessment and data intelligently to keep standards high and close gaps quickly
  • contribute to wider Academy life - enrichment matters here, and creative subjects are a big part of what makes school memorable

Requirements:

  • Strong classroom practitioner with the presence to lead others and the humility to keep learning
  • track record or clear potential to improve outcomes and build consistency across a team
  • can combine high expectations with real relational warmth
  • brings a "let's make it happen" mindset aligned to Oasis values of aspiration, achievement, care and resilience
What we offer:
  • Access to strong CPD
  • Trust-wide networking
  • opportunities to progress
  • leadership culture that backs its people
  • modern purpose-built campus
  • technology that supports learning through iPads
